Output e31da83369294574592a76f587b65d0bdccc7fdacd2f14ddb045b8a018269baa:81

value
11342700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d3ffd64da7e5b01663112f7c2a079ac855656ed OP_EQUALVERIFY OP_CHECKSIG
address
1Dsrw93iZBSnv5PipCnWBipYhFbas3N2Su
transaction
e31da83369294574592a76f587b65d0bdccc7fdacd2f14ddb045b8a018269baa
confirmations
234107
spent
true